我有一个相对简单的React组件,根据它的状态呈现一个列表。然后我有一个业力/茉莉测试,它呈现组件,设置其状态,并检查是否呈现了正确的标记。
我遇到的问题是,每次在组件上执行setState({})或forceUpdate()时,我都会得到一个错误:
TypeError: 'undefined' is not an object (evaluating 'deepestAncestor.firstChild')
at /home/company/projects/user_interface_kit/bower_components/react/
我正在使用带有backbone的RequireJS,我想知道什么时候应该返回一个实例,什么时候应该返回一个类定义。
例如,我有一个模型that I need only one instance of it,我只需要它的一个实例。我应该在RequireJS模型模块中还是在appView初始化中实例化它?
define([
'Underscore',
'Backbone'
], function(_, Backbone) {
var TermModel = Backbone.Model.extend({
我在我的Javascript应用程序中使用模块模式,我想迁移到RequireJS和AMD。
我目前的实现如下:
// Module main : Module.js
var myModule = (function(my, $, undefined) {
'use strict';
var m_privateMembers;
var m_stuff = new my.Pear({color:"green"});
//---------------------------------------
function pr
一旦将RequireJS添加到BackboneJS应用程序中,我就无法访问chrome控制台中的实例变量。
示例如下:
仅限BackboneJS:
打开chrome控制台,输入keys(窗口),找到在各种BackboneJS脚本中使用的实例变量"app“:
// instance variable app is also found under window
keys(window)
["top", "window", "location", "external", "chrome", "Intl&
我试图将JQuery包含在一个用maven构建的web应用程序中,使用RequireJS来定义Javascript模块。
我遵循了RequireJS文档,它解释了如何在RequireJS中使用JQuery。此外,我还有一个maven构建。
我所做的是:
我的main.js,由RequireJS在HTML中的数据主程序调用。
define(function() {
// Configuration of RequireJS
requirejs.config({
// No module can start with require. This can potentiall